Outpatient Transport Coordinator

Function : Coordinates the transportation of families and individuals involved with the KSTEP / OP programs to medical and / or mental health appointments.  Works with other transporters to ensure that all transportation needs are covered and fills in for other transporters as necessary.  Provides supervision and performance oversight of the other OP Transporters.Organizational duties & responsibilities :

  • The primary responsibility of all staff is to ensure the safety and well-being of all Ramey-Estep / Re-group (RE) clients.
  • Supports the mission, vision, and values of RE.  Facilitates and adheres to the agency’s code of ethics, policies, and procedures.
  • Supports all functions that attain and maintain accreditation and compliance with regulatory agencies.
  • Supports and facilitates positive interaction with clients and staff by exhibiting both in-office and in-public when carrying out job duties :   individual maturity, respect for others, a team-centered approach, maintenance of confidential information, and awareness and sensitivity to cultural and other differences in clients and staff.
  • Exhibits effective communication skills, including proper use of agency communication systems.
  • Participates in appropriate professional development programs to attain and maintain competency.
  • Effectively manages financial and physical resources to achieve the mission of RE.
  • Reports incidents of abuse or potential abuse involving clients to the appropriate authorities and RE.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ities :

  • Transports clients to medical appointments as needed in the community.
  • Assures availability of materials and supplies and ensures the provision of a clean and safe environment for clients and staff.
  • Documents each request for transportation on the Transportation Record Form in the family EHR record.
  • Coordinates all the transportation needs of KSTEP clients to all agency locations.
  • Manages the OP Transporter schedules and works to keep overtime at a minimum when possible.
  • Provides performance supervision and oversight to the OP Transporters and handles performance issues appropriately.
  • Responsible for providing initial on-the-job training for new OP Transporters.
  • Assists in the interview process for OP Transporters.
  • Maintains an approachable image when in the community and representing the agency while on transport.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Working conditions / environment :

  • Varied shifts within a twenty-four-hour schedule.
  • Holidays, weekends, evenings, and overtime may be required.
  • Intense, unpredictable population with the possibility of verbal and physical aggression.
  • Fast-paced environment with the need for quick decisions to deal with any crisis that may arise.
  • minimum job requirements : Education : High School Diploma or GED required.  Experience : Previous supervisory experience preferred.Specific Skills andrequirements : Must be at least 21 years of age.

    Must have excellent communication and conflict resolution skills.

    Technical requirements include pro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and any other applications used by the organization or regulatory agencies.

    Ability to understand and relate to the needs of clients from diverse backgrounds.

    Ability to read, write and converse in English.

    Successful completion of a pre-employment drug screen.

    Successful completion of a background screening.

    Successful completion of a TB skin test or proof of a negative chest x-ray or other documentation.Specialized Licenses or training : Successful completion of Excellent Foundations.

    Maintain 20 hours of annual training.

    Maintain CPR / 1st Aid training.Physical Requirements : The physical requirements described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to perform the essential functions of this job successfully.  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ions.

    While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and, walk, talk, hear, and smell.  The employee frequently is required to sit;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ms; and stoop, kneel, crouch, and climb stairs.  The employee is occasionally required to climb, balance or run.  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, and peripheral vision.  Supervisory REquirements : Provides direct supervision of the OP Transport Team.
